Illustrator with a soft spot for anthropology, peculiar animals and interesting stories. Born in Sardinia, living in Milan, missing the sea all the time.  My name is Roberta Ragona but it’s way easier to find me as Tostoini.  My experience in  illustration ranges from picture books and editorial to museums set-ups, educational materials, brand communication, advertising, websites, apps, to graphic recording and visual facilitation. I have a penchant for non-fiction illustration and a silly sense of humour.  I love projects that tackle serious topics with a bit of lightness, and and silly things explored with absolute seriousness. My first book as author&illustrator “Fossili Viventi” (Living Fossils), is published by Aboca Kids and got a 2nd place in Science Communication in Children Books from Giancarlo Dosi National Prize for Science Communication by the National Research Council (CNR).
